When he wakes up, he gets 4oz of WCM. About 30 -45 minutes later, he'll start whining, so I know he's hungry, and he eats breakfast. He eats a little morning snack about an hour before nap #1, then right before nap #1, he gets 4oz of WCM. When he wakes up from nap #1, he's usually hungry about 30 minutes afterward, so he gets lunch with a cup of juice. An hour before nap #2 is an afternoon snack with a little water if he seems thirsty (he just drinks a few sips from my cup - we eat snack together). Right before nap #2, 4oz bottle of WCM. About an hour after nap #2, dinner, then right before bed, 4oz of WCM.
I have no idea if I'm doing this right, but he seems satisfied, and he's used to the bottle being a part of his routine for nap/night sleep. This Gerber thing I have says he should be getting 16-22 oz of WCM and usually, he'll take after 14 of the 16 I offer him.
